What is enthalpy change of vaporisation
The enthalpy change when 1 mole of a substance changes from liquid to gas at its boiling point
standard enthalpy change of combustion
The enthalpy change that occurs when 1 mole of substance completely combusts
average bond enthalpy
breaking of 1 mole of bonds in gaseous molecules
enthalpy change of hydration
the enthalpy change when 1 mole of gaseous ions dissolves in water
Enthalpy of formation
enthalpy change when 1 mole of a compound is formed from its substituent elements in standard conditions
homolytic fission
splitting of a bond to form 2 radicals
heterolytic fission
splitting of a bond to form 2 oppositely charged ions
nucleophile
electron pair donor
electrophile
electron pair acceptor
bronsted-lowry acid
proton donor
bronsted-lowry base
proton acceptor
buffer solution
a solution that minimises pH changes on addition of small amounts of acid or base
equivalence point
point in a titration when the amount of acid is equal to the amount of base
enthalpy change of solution
enthalpy change when 1 mole of an ionic compound dissolves in water
First Ionisation Energy
the energy required to remove 1 mole of electrons from 1 mole of gaseous atoms to form 1 mole of gaseous 1+ ion
standard electrode potential
the e.m.f of a half cell compared to the standard hydrogen half cell under standard conditions (1 moldm-3, 100KPa, 298K)
bidentate ligand
species that has 2 lone pairs that can be donated to form 2 coordinate bonds with the central metal ion
Transition Elements
element that can form 1 or more ions with incomplete d-sub shells
lattice enthalpy
the enthalpy change when 1 mole of a solid ionic lattice is formed from its gaseous ions
First Electron Affinity
the enthalpy change when 1 mole of electrons is added to 1 mole of gaseous atoms, forming 1 mole of gaseous 1- ions
Enthalpy Change of Atomisation (ΔH):
enthalpy change when 1 mole of gaseous atoms is formed from an element in its standard state
entropy (S)
a measure of the dispersal and disorder of energy in a system
